What Future CAGR is Anticipated for the AI Accelerator Market Over the 2025–2034 Period?
The market size of AI accelerators has seen a significant boost in recent times. The projection is for it to expand from a valuation of $16.55 billion for the year 2024, reaching up to $20.95 billion by 2025, representing a Compound Annual Growth Rate (CAGR) of 26.6%. The spike in growth over the historical period can be credited to rising demand for deep learning frameworks, increased government funding, higher adoption rates of AI in image and speech recognition technologies, greater application of AI in precision agriculture, and a surge in consumer electronics.
The market size for AI accelerators is predicted to experience significant expansion in the coming years, potentially reaching a value of $53.23 billion by 2029, with a compound annual growth rate (CAGR) of 26.2%. Factors contributing to this projected growth during the forecast period include the escalating deployment of AI servers, a swelling demand for real-time data processing, the expanding use of IoT devices, increased funding for AI research, and a surge in consumer data production. Noteworthy trends anticipated during the forecast period encompass technological progression, machine learning, AI solutions based in the cloud, AI chips, and cybersecurity.
What Combination of Drivers Is Leading to Accelerated Growth in the AI Accelerator Market?
The AI accelerator market is foreseen to surge due to the escalating use of IoT devices. These IoT devices, which encompass physical objects embedded with sensors, software, and features of connectivity, have the ability to collect, process and exchange data via the internet. The escalation in their deployment stems from factors like the rising demand for automation, enhanced connectivity, and an increase in consumer adoption of smart devices. AI accelerators significantly aid IoT devices in processing data locally, thus limiting the necessity for cloud transmission. This leads to quicker decision-making procedures, decreased latency, and less bandwidth use, thereby amplifying efficiency in real-time applications such as smart homes, industrial automation, and healthcare. For instance, as per an Ericsson report in April 2024, global IoT connections which were 15.7 billion in 2023, are anticipated to witness a 16% jump to 38.8 billion connections by 2029. Thus, the escalating use of IoT devices is fueling the growth of the AI accelerator market.

What Impact Are Industry Trends Having on the AI Accelerator Market’s Future Prospects?
Prominent corporations in the AI accelerator market are putting their efforts into the development of superior technologies like the 5 nm node process technology. This stride is aimed at boosting overall system performance, bettering power efficiency, and catering to the escalated requirements of AI operations. In layman terms, the 5 nm node process technology is a distinct semiconductor manufacturing process where the transistors measure just about 5 nanometers, leading to enhanced productivity, decreased energy use, and compact chip models. Illustrating this development, IBM, an American tech firm, unveiled the Spyre accelerator chip in August 2024. This revolutionary AI unit, crafted for IBM Z networks, is fortified with 32 cores and 25.6 billion transistors made using 5nm node technology to provide improved performance and maximize power efficiency. The unit is installed on PCIe cards that can be grouped together to spike up processing ability and accommodate large-scale AI inferencing. It also back up intricate utilities like fraud detection and generative AI, crucial for streamlining business operations and code modernization. The innovative architecture of Spyre is primed to manage AI workloads, enabling enterprises to safely and effectively implement AI models on-premises.

How Do Experts Define the Scope of the AI Accelerator Market?
AI accelerators refer to specialized hardware or software designed to speed up and optimize artificial intelligence computations. It offers a wide range of uses and benefits for developers, businesses, cloud service providers, and other stakeholders in the AI technology ecosystem.
